What Is Hyaron?

Hyaron is a non-crosslinked hyaluronic acid (HA) skin booster. Hyaluronic acid is a substance naturally found in the skin that attracts and retains water, helping maintain hydration, elasticity, and smoothness.

Unlike crosslinked HA fillers that create volume, Hyaron spreads evenly throughout the skin to improve hydration and skin quality rather than changing facial shape.

How Does Hyaron Work?

After being injected into the superficial dermis, Hyaron attracts water molecules and increases the skin's moisture content.

This helps to:

  • Deeply hydrate the skin
  • Improve skin elasticity
  • Smooth rough texture
  • Enhance skin radiance
  • Reduce the appearance of fine dehydration lines

As skin becomes better hydrated, it often appears healthier, firmer, and more luminous.

Hyaron vs Dermal Fillers

Although both contain hyaluronic acid, they serve very different purposes.

Hyaron

Designed for:

  • Hydration
  • Skin quality
  • Elasticity
  • Natural glow
  • Overall rejuvenation

It does not add noticeable facial volume.

Dermal Fillers

Designed for:

  • Volume restoration
  • Facial contouring
  • Lip enhancement
  • Chin augmentation
  • Cheek enhancement

Choosing between them depends on whether your goal is healthier skin or structural facial enhancement.

Can Hyaron Be Combined with Laser Treatments?

Yes.

Hyaron is frequently paired with treatments such as:

  • Pico laser
  • Fractional laser
  • Laser toning
  • RF microneedling
  • Vascular laser

Laser treatments stimulate collagen and address pigmentation or texture, while Hyaron replenishes hydration and supports smoother recovery.

This combination often enhances overall skin quality.

How Many Sessions Are Needed?

Most patients begin with:

  • 3 sessions
  • Every 2–4 weeks

Maintenance treatments every 3–6 months are commonly recommended to maintain hydration and skin radiance.

When Will You See Results?

Many patients notice:

  • Better hydration within several days
  • Brighter skin
  • Improved smoothness
  • A healthier glow

Because hydration occurs relatively quickly, results are often visible sooner than collagen-stimulating treatments.

Is There Any Downtime?

Recovery is generally minimal.

Patients may experience:

  • Mild redness
  • Small injection bumps
  • Slight swelling
  • Minor bruising

These effects usually resolve within one or two days.
